Something smells fishy here. The statement "The motorcycle would be priced between Rs 1.50 lakh and Rs 2 lakh in India. "The bookings would start just ahead of Diwali and the deliveries would happen immediately," Bajaj stated.", raises a few eyebrows.
I mean, the article says that the bike is going to be launched on october 5th, that means there are just 12 odd days left bedore launch. Now what this article suggests is that even 12 days before that launch of a major product, the MD of the company does not have a specific price for the product! Somehow I find that hard to believe.
This could mean either of the following two things, as far as i can think.
1. The MD is trying to keep the price a secret from the competition for as long as he can by giving a broad range spanning Rs. 50k. This would serve a two fold purpose: keep the buzz going in the market and give sleepless nights to competitors which they will spend wondering whether the price is possible and how can they repond to it.
2. The announcement is merely a better iteration of the earlier announcements where bajaj just gave a random month for the launch of ninja. Now they have started prefixing the month with a date.
